Biography

Sonu Singh is a biomedical engineer and patent professional currently serving as an Examiner of Patents and Designs at the Office of the Controller General of Patents, Designs and Trade Marks (CGPDTM), Government of India. He obtained his Ph.D. in Biomedical Engineering from the Indian Institute of Technology (IIT) Delhi as a Prime Minister’s Research Fellowship (PMRF) awardee, graduating with distinction (CGPA 9.45). His doctoral research focused on the design and development of additively manufactured porous Ti6Al4V implants with integrated drug-eluting and biofunctional characteristics aimed at enhancing osteogenesis and enabling localized therapeutic delivery in orthopedic and oncological applications.

Expertise

Dr. Sonu Singh’s expertise lies at the convergence of biomaterials engineering, additive manufacturing, and medical device innovation, with a strong emphasis on translational and regulatory integration. His core research focuses on the design and development of architected porous metallic biomaterials, particularly titanium based lattice structures, for orthopedic applications, incorporating drug-eluting functionalities and nanostructured surface modifications to enhance osteogenesis and therapeutic efficacy . He possesses experience in advanced manufacturing techniques, including laser-based metal additive manufacturing and surface functionalization, as well as in vitro biological evaluation of biomaterials. His work also encompasses mechanical characterization, fatigue analysis, and fluid permeability assessments of open-cell scaffold architectures. In addition to technical expertise, Dr. Singh has significant proficiency in medical device regulatory frameworks and intellectual property systems, including ISO 13485, ISO 14971, and patent examination processes. His current role as a patent examiner further strengthens his capability in innovation assessment. He also demonstrates competence in interdisciplinary domains such as biofabrication, cell-material interactions, and device design, enabling him to bridge fundamental research with clinical and industrial translation.
